Ricardo “Rick” Fernandez

My name is Rick Fernandez, candidate for Board of County Commissioners, District 3.

I was born in Ybor City and raised in Tampa Heights. My parents, Ray and Josie (Giglio) were born in Ybor City and West Tampa respectively, in the early 1900’s. Son Michael is 26 and a Tampa Prep/Oregon State grad. My partner in life is Connie Rose, high school sweetheart, professional trainer and fierce advocate for survivors of human trafficking.

Education: Sacred Heart Academy (’68), Jesuit High School (’72), University of Florida _ Political Science Honors (’75), Stetson University College of Law (’78).

Bar Admission: Florida 1978, California 1982 (inactive)

Military: US Navy JAGC 1978 – 1984 (Navy Lawyer) | San Diego, Naples and USS John F. Kennedy (CV-67)

After leaving the Navy, I pursued a trial practice in Tampa until 2000. Most of that time (12 years), I was a Shareholder at the Shackleford Farrior firm (n/k/a Gray Robinson).

Representative Activities (1984 – 2000): President Hillsborough County Bar Association; Florida Bar Board of Governors; President Bay Area Legal Services Board of Directors; Board Certified Civil Trial Lawyer; Leadership Tampa; Florida Bar President’s Pro Bono Service Award (Homeless Outreach Project).

Beginning in 2000, I reinvented myself as a Legal Recruiter, Chief Recruiting Officer, Hiring Partner and Career Coach. I’ve worn those hats for two of the largest law firms in Florida: Shutts Bowen and Fowler White (n/k/a Buchanan Ingersoll). I left Shutts in September 2019 and have continued in the recruiting arena under my own banner, Fernandez Consulting Services, Inc.

Path back home: I moved back to Tampa Heights in 2012. My intent was to be part of the community’s resurgence. Involvement began at the Community Garden compost pit (kid you not) and grew from there (pun intended). Soon, I was on the Board of the Tampa Heights Civic Association and was elected President in January 2016.

Representative Activities (2013 – Present): Vice Chair, MPO Citizens Advisory Committee by appointment of Commissioner Les Miller (2017 – Present); Independent Oversight Committee, Transportation Surtax Funding (AFT), by appointment of Tampa City Council (2019 – present); Tampa Heights Civic Associaiton, President (2016 – 2019), Transportation Committee Chair (2019 – Present), Board Member (2013 – 2020); Neighborhood Activist and Transit Advocate (2013 – Present)

Tony Morejon

Tony Morejon is a former Hillsborough County Community Affairs Liaison,

Tony served as the Community Affairs Liaison for the Hillsborough County Center from 1994-2018. He was responsible for establishing and maintaining relations between Hillsborough County government and its diverse community. In 2005, he worked with FEMA and created the first bilingual hurricane/disaster preparedness conference event in the nation.

Tony has been the host of “Informes Latinos” since 1995. The show is Hillsborough County’s longest running television and Spanish language program which conveys information about Hillsborough County Government and its services. He has also served as co-host for “Vistas” since 1999, an award-winning television program dedicated to showcasing Hillsborough County’s Hispanic and Latin influences. He is also an avid fisherman and outdoorsman. However, Tony’s favorite lifetime accomplishment is his three children and two grandchildren.
